WhatsApp employs End-to-End Encryption (E2EE) utilizing the Signal Protocol. This implies that messages are secured on the sender's device and can just be decrypted by the designated recipient's device. Not even Meta (the moms and dad company) can read the messages in transit.
To bypass this, a "hacker" would basically need to:
Compromise the physical device: Using malware or Pegasus-style spyware.Make use of the backup system: Accessing unencrypted backups on Google Drive or iCloud (if the user hasn't enabled encrypted backups).Social Engineering: Tricking the user into sharing their 6-digit registration code or scanning a WhatsApp Web QR code.The Legal and Ethical Landscape

While some seek to Hire Hacker For Whatsapp a Discreet Hacker Services, it is equally important to comprehend how to defend against these extremely attempts. WhatsApp provides numerous built-in functions to prevent unapproved access.
Vital Security Checklist:
Enable Two-Step Verification: This includes a PIN that must be gotten in when resetting or confirming the account.Disable Cloud Backups (or Encrypt Them): If backups are not encrypted, they are the most typical entry point for trespassers.Review Linked Devices: Regularly check "Linked Devices" in settings to make sure no unapproved computers are logged into your WhatsApp Web.Use Biometric Locks: Enable Fingerprint or FaceID locks for the app itself within the personal privacy settings.Alternatives to "Hacking"

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Is it in fact possible to hack a WhatsApp account?
Technically, yes, but it is exceptionally tough due to end-to-end file encryption. The majority of "hacks" occur through social engineering (fooling the user), accessing unencrypted cloud backups, or using advanced, expensive spyware usually scheduled for nation-states.
2. Can I hire a hacker to recuperate my own deleted messages?
Typically, a hacker can not recuperate deleted messages that were not supported. If the messages are deleted from both the device and the cloud, they are likely gone forever. A genuine information healing specialist might be able to help if they have physical access to the hardware, but "remote" healing by a hacker is almost constantly a fraud.
